Estate Heritage
Château Siran Margaux proudly represents over 160 years of family stewardship and winemaking excellence. Located in the southern part of the Margaux appellation, this 25-hectare estate has been owned by the Miailhe family since the 19th century, with each generation contributing to its long-standing reputation for quality. The property gained recognition for its wines as early as the 18th century, a testament to its historic significance.
Unique Terroir
The vineyards of Château Siran thrive on deep gravel and clayey soils, perfect for cultivating high-quality Cabernet Sauvignon, Merlot, and Petit Verdot grapes. This composition, combined with vines averaging 31-38 years in age, ensures each harvest captures the essence of the Margaux region. Their dedication to sustainable viticulture—eschewing chemical herbicides and relying on manual harvesting—helps preserve the vineyard’s natural character while maintaining environmental integrity.
Craftsmanship in Every Bottle
At the heart of Château Siran’s winemaking is a meticulous attention to detail. Grapes are hand-picked into small crates, preserving their integrity. Further precision is applied during vinification, with parcel-by-parcel thermo-regulated fermentation that highlights the unique attributes of each vineyard plot. The use of small stainless steel vats allows for controlled fermentation, specifically tailored to bring out the best qualities in each grape variety.
Tasting Profile
Château Siran Margaux captivates with its aromatic complexity, showcasing vibrant notes of blackcurrant, cherry, and violet in its youth. With time, these evolve into sophisticated aromas of truffle, tobacco leaf, and cedarwood, reflecting the wine’s aging potential. Its palate offers a balance of powerful yet refined tannins, with a silky mouthfeel that becomes even more pronounced over time, culminating in a persistent finish marked by a hint of spice and minerality from the Petit Verdot.
Aging and Cellaring
One of the defining features of Château Siran Margaux is its remarkable aging potential. While enjoyable in its earlier years, the wine truly excels after 5-7 years of cellaring, continuing to mature gracefully for up to two decades. As it ages, Château Siran reveals deeper flavors and aromas, making it a rewarding experience for those patient enough to wait.
Complementary Pairings
Thoughtfully crafted to pair well with a variety of dishes, Château Siran shines alongside roast lamb, grilled beef, duck with cherry reduction, and mushroom risotto. It also complements aged cheeses such as Comté and Aged Gouda perfectly, making it a versatile addition to any dinner table.
